Tear-free shampoos are specifically designed to be gentle on the eyes and skin, making them a popular choice for children. These shampoos are formulated to minimize the risk of irritation and tears during bath time. While the term “tear-free” may suggest that the product is completely safe, it’s essential to understand that it refers to the product’s potential to cause fewer tears, not the absence of tears altogether.

The primary reason tear-free shampoos are safe is their gentle formula. These shampoos contain mild surfactants that are less likely to irritate the eyes and skin. Traditional shampoos often contain harsh surfactants that can cause tears and discomfort when they come into contact with the eyes. By using tear-free shampoos, you can reduce the risk of eye irritation and ensure a more comfortable bath time for your child.

Another factor that contributes to the safety of tear-free shampoos is their hypoallergenic nature. These shampoos are formulated to be free from allergens and irritants, making them suitable for sensitive skin. This is particularly important for children with eczema or other skin conditions, as tear-free shampoos can help prevent further irritation and discomfort.

When it comes to the ingredients in tear-free shampoos, it’s crucial to choose products that are free from harmful chemicals. Look for shampoos that are free from sulfates, parabens, and phthalates, as these ingredients have been linked to various health concerns. Opt for tear-free shampoos that use natural, plant-based ingredients, such as aloe vera, chamomile, and cucumber, which can provide soothing properties for your child’s hair and skin.

It’s also essential to follow proper usage instructions when using tear-free shampoos. Always ensure that your child’s eyes are closed during the application process and avoid getting the shampoo into their eyes. If accidental contact occurs, rinse the eyes thoroughly with water immediately. By adhering to these guidelines, you can minimize the risk of irritation and ensure a safe bath time for your little one.
